什么是小部件?

动力你最喜欢的博客的魔法gizmos

网页设计,Web窗口小部件是扩展网页或网站的功能的小组件。Word窗口小部件普遍地与托管内容管理系统相关联WordPress.,管理员将小部件中包含的新功能插入到博客的网页中。

什么是小部件?

小部件在另一个网站内运行不同网站的一小部分,类似于一个iframe.。例如,Facebook的小部件可能会嵌入Facebook登录或评论框。主机网站可能很少或根本不了解窗口小部件中发生的内容,具体取决于服务的配置方式。小部件就像一个窗口到另一个网站的功能和功能,其中您具有可变的可见性和控制。

网站与小部件

自定义网站在时尚之后,也将小部件包含了使用开源代码或框架,以全部或部分提供某些功能。例如,注释功能通常由Disqus插件处理,该功能连接到Facebook的登录功能。这些网站也可以添加rss.或者播客特征。此功能可以被视为小部件,尽管该术语在很大程度上已经偏离了更多的通用术语插入和整合。

无论哪种方式,窗口小部件都是自包含的代码块,该代码块插入网站而不更改任何网站的核心功能。虽然小部件逐渐不那么受销售实体的流行,但小部件仍然以插件和扩展的形式找到。

使用Web小部件

小部件提供与其他平台同步的屏幕上的用户界面元素。例如,新闻文章中看到的社交媒体图标是一种窗口小部件。这些使得可以轻松分享具有小型嵌入式程序的内容。

小部件可以在网站上的任何网页上运行,具有一致的展示位置和用户界面。与社交媒体平台的连接由小部件中的代码管理,从学习和了解每个社交媒体平台的情况下保存Web开发人员蜜蜂工作。

如果您是网络设计师,您可能会知道该信息。但是,大多数编辑都集中在功能可用的网站上,鼓励用户互动和阅读更多。他们没有时间了解API是什么或者JSON如何写入。相反,他们将窗口小部件插入到他们的网站上,社交媒体集成完成。

小部件的主要好处是易用性。编码新手可以轻松地将一组令人印象深刻的功能粘贴到他们的新博客中,升级他们的网站的功能和用户体验,而无需从头开始设计功能。

小部件的缺点

Web设计人员也可能受到窗口小部件的设计限制。在使用时总是如此第三方代码。如果您不完全明白软件的内容,那么软件正在做一些不受欢迎的事情。在最好的场景中,这是一个无害的低效率。

但在一个最坏的情况下,小部件可以在访问者的计算机上执行恶意客户端代码。这就是为什么只使用来自可信资源的小部件至关重要,或者事先确认小部件只做他们所说的,而且没有更多。当外部代码集成到任何风险投资中时,这是安全风险,而不是小部件的特殊负担。Node.js模块带来风险。

此页面是否有帮助?